pNeuton Ventilator
8 - 2
Indication Meaning
Corrective
Action
Lower minute
volume than
desired
Insufficient driving
gas supply
Check gas source,
55 psi (380 kPa) at
40 L/min is required
Leak in the Patient
Circuit or Expiratory
Valve
Replace patient
circuit
Obstruction of gas
output
Check or replace
patient circuit
Use in hyperbaric
condition
Ventilator should not
be used in
hyperbaric conditions
Tidal
volume
control
out of calibration
Send ventilator for
service
Internal malfunction
Send ventilator for
service
Higher minute
volume then
desired
Use at higher
altitude then
calibration
Use external
spirometer to verify
tidal volume
Tidal
volume
control
out of calibration
Send ventilator for
service
Internal malfunction
Send ventilator for
service
Tidal volume
inaccurate
Leak in the patient
ET-Tube, mask,
breathing circuit or
expiratory valve
Check patient
interface. Replace
patient circuit if at
fault
Ventilator
is
operating at an
altitude different
then calibration
Tidal volume should
be measured by an
external spirometer
Tidal
volume
control
out of cal
Send ventilator for
service
Rate control
inaccurate
Tidal volume set
below 500 ml or
above 900 ml
This is normal. Rate
will be faster when
tidal volume is set
lower than 500 ml.
Rate will be slower
when tidal volume is
set higher than 900
ml
Rate control out of
cal
Send ventilator for
service
